Commit graph

86 commits

Author SHA1 Message Date
David Remer
b032a8ea14 make logging optional 2020-07-10 15:45:49 +03:00
David Remer
34f0836c15 add brand_name setting 2020-07-10 11:50:11 +03:00
David Remer
713d5bdda1 PCP-21 / add option for button label 2020-07-10 10:27:03 +03:00
David Remer
792fce5b3a add default values to Settings 2020-07-10 09:08:50 +03:00
David Remer
7536efbe3a fix translation slug 2020-07-10 08:51:02 +03:00
David Remer
8fef1ec612 do only overwrite settings, which can be altered in current screen 2020-07-10 08:41:23 +03:00
David Remer
27966d47f9 add CachePoolFactory reference 2020-07-09 09:18:16 +03:00
David Remer
7fb1e25ad8 clear cache when changing settings 2020-07-09 09:10:35 +03:00
David Remer
687b7b7606 change email field, add webhook registrar to onboardinglistener 2020-07-08 13:27:48 +03:00
David Remer
250e127afc disable WcGateway if no merchant_email is present 2020-07-02 14:37:08 +03:00
David Remer
68708607f4 cleanup, connect gateway with settings 2020-07-02 14:30:03 +03:00
David Remer
9563d60427 add onboarding field to settings 2020-07-02 13:10:53 +03:00
David Remer
f09d71e888 phpcs 2020-07-02 12:48:40 +03:00
David Remer
4dadd6143f replace wc gateway settings with independent settings system 2020-07-02 09:37:07 +03:00
David Remer
3b35d6a0ee add reset button 2020-06-30 11:04:19 +03:00
David Remer
71501e85d2 add reset possibility 2020-06-30 08:35:28 +03:00
David Remer
98d201968e onboarding init 2020-06-15 11:48:37 +03:00
David Remer
a09a4e1e3d move payment process out of wc gateway 2020-04-28 13:32:48 +03:00
David Remer
9dc3c073d2 codestyle 2020-04-28 12:31:12 +03:00
Mészáros Róbert
25c09fb198 Rename payment status related classes 2020-04-23 11:24:43 +03:00
Mészáros Róbert
7e41ca3852 Display authorized payment captured state on the orders table 2020-04-22 19:27:07 +03:00
Mészáros Róbert
24dd72142b Add option to display the payment status 2020-04-22 16:07:02 +03:00
Mészáros Róbert
8e4af5766e Create a processor class to handle the authorized payments 2020-04-16 15:19:57 +03:00
Mészáros Róbert
210b7d6845 Create and pass the payments endpoint to the gateway 2020-04-14 16:08:24 +03:00
Mészáros Róbert
479572cfc7 Merge branch 'master' into feature/create-order-intent-authorize
# Conflicts:
#	modules.local/ppcp-api-client/services.php
#	modules.local/ppcp-button/src/Assets/SmartButton.php
2020-04-14 11:22:31 +03:00
David Remer
c7aa53a8e4 resolve merge conflict 2020-04-14 08:24:45 +03:00
Mészáros Róbert
b655750485 Change order string payment 2020-04-13 22:33:50 +03:00
Mészáros Róbert
84fd6e552d Use a base gateway class with minimal config 2020-04-13 14:57:53 +03:00
David Remer
79a6c6d7c3 introduce payeeRepository // PCP-8 2020-04-13 09:07:20 +03:00
Mészáros Róbert
2974ac9ad8 Rename ConnectNotice to ConnectAdminNotice 2020-04-10 12:36:42 +03:00
Mészáros Róbert
3cb0f9c19e Display a notice when the plugin is activated but the gateway is not configured 2020-04-10 12:20:08 +03:00
Mészáros Róbert
8ff6ef7bd5 Run Code Beautifier and Fixer 2020-04-09 14:36:52 +03:00
Mészáros Róbert
d7f2e33e60 Add settings and settings field class 2020-04-09 14:06:22 +03:00
David Remer
005a55c213 phpcs 2020-04-06 11:16:18 +03:00
David Remer
7fd57b9393 2nd chunk 2020-04-06 10:51:56 +03:00
David Remer
779eb31e4e init 2020-04-02 08:38:00 +03:00